Assembly Services provides prototyping, test, measurement and production for high accuracy and complex wire and die attach applications. To meet increasing customer demand, additional clean room space was recently added in the California-based laboratory, increasing production capacity by 50%. Assembly Services expertise includes development and production for applications such as HB LEDs, RF power modules, military hybrids and laser diode packages.

About Palomar Technologies
Palomar Technologies, a former subsidiary of Hughes Aircraft, is the global leader of automated high-accuracy, large work area die attach and wire bond equipment and precision contract assembly services. Customers utilize the products, services and solutions from Palomar Technologies to meet their needs for optoelectronic packaging, complex hybrid assembly and micron-level component attachment.
